Mexico - Export of Parts of Electronic Integrated Circuits
Since 2014, Mexico Export of Parts of Electronic Integrated Circuits grew 48.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 41 among other countries in Export of Parts of Electronic Integrated Circuits at $1,987,958. Mexico is overtaken by Greece, which was ranked number 40 with $2,085,042.38 and is followed by South Africa at $1,671,419.12. Malaysia ranked the highest with $3,130,267,479.78 in 2019, that is +3.5% compared to 2018. Japan, Singapore and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Botswana recorded the best 5 years average growth at +243.1% per year, while Jamaica was the worst growing country at -60.1% per year.
